全面解析火币区块链API:构建你的加密货币应用

                  发布时间:2025-04-15 18:36:48
                    全面解析火币区块链API:构建你的加密货币应用之路 / 
 guanjianci 火币API, 区块链技术, 加密货币交易, 开发者工具 /guanjianci 

什么是火币区块链API?
火币区块链API是火币交易所提供的一组程序接口,允许开发者与火币平台进行直接的交互。这些API可以用来执行多种操作,包括获取市场数据、进行交易、管理账户等功能。这些接口使用REST架构,能够支持RESTful API调用,对于开发者来说具有较高的易用性。

火币作为全球领先的数字资产交易平台,其API被广泛应用于多种加密货币应用的开发。不论是个人开发者还是大型企业,都可以通过火币API接口实现快速的功能集成和系统搭建。由于其开放性和灵活性,火币API在区块链开发者圈中占有重要地位。

火币API提供哪些功能?
火币区块链API提供了一系列功能,包括但不限于:
ul
   listrong市场数据查询:/strong可以获取实时的市场行情,包括价格、交易量、买卖深度等信息。/li
   listrong用户账户管理:/strong用户可以通过API进行账户信息的查询、修改及管理,包括资产查询、交易历史等。/li
   listrong交易功能:/strong用户可以使用API发起新订单、撤单、查询订单状态等操作。/li
   listrong安全性措施:/strong支持多种身份验证方式,保障用户数据和资金的安全。/li
/ul

如何使用火币区块链API进行交易?
使用火币API进行交易主要包括几个步骤。首先,你需要创建一个火币账户并完成身份验证。之后,访问火币API的开发者中心,申请API密钥,并配置相关权限。接下来,你可以使用编程语言(如Python、Java等)调用API进行交易操作。以下是使用火币API进行交易的一般步骤:


1. strong获取API密钥:/strong在火币官网上登录账户,访问API管理页面,获取你的API钥匙和密钥。一定要妥善保管这些信息,以防被恶意使用。



2. strong选择合适的编程语言:/strong火币API支持多种编程语言,你可以根据自己的开发环境选择如Python或JavaScript等流行语言。



3. strong进行Api调用:/strong使用HTTP请求方法(如GET、POST)进行API调用。你可以查看火币API文档,了解各种请求的具体参数和返回值结构。



4. strong处理返回结果:/strong成功发起交易后,你将收到交易状态的返回信息。你需要根据这些返回结果进行相应的处理。


火币API的安全性策略有哪些?
安全性是火币API设计中的重中之重。火币交易所采取了多种安全机制,确保用户的交易和数据不受侵犯。主要的安全措施包括:
ul
   listrongAPI密钥管理:/strong用户在创建API密钥时,可以自行设定相应的权限,包括仅允许查询、仅允许交易等,这样在一定程度上降低了风险。/li
   listrongIP白名单:/strong用户可以设置允许访问API的IP地址,这样即便API密钥被盗用,也无法从非白名单的IP地址进行操作。/li
   listrong请求签名:/strong所有通过API进行的请求,都需要进行签名处理,确保请求的完整性和合法性。/li
/ul

常见问题及解答

1. 如何解决API调用失败的问题?
当调用火币API遇到失败时,首先需要查看返回的错误码和错误信息。火币API文档中对各种错误进行了详细解释。常见的错误包括401(未授权)、429(请求频率过高)、500(服务器错误)等。对于401错误,通常是因为API密钥无效或未授权,需检查密钥的设置与权限;对于429错误,要减少请求频率,避免频繁调用;而500错误需要等待火币服务器恢复正常,或是联系火币客服解决。
建议在开发时实现错误处理机制,定期重试失败的请求,并合理安排API的调用频率,遵循火币API的速率限制说明。

2. 火币API的调用频率限制是怎样的?
火币对API调用频率设有严格限制,不同的API权限设置有不同的限制标准。具体的频率限制可以在火币API文档中查找。一般情况下,用户将不能在短时间内持续发送请求,而应在发送API请求后,遵循一定的休眠时间。
例如,对于市场查询类API的调用,可能在一分钟内限制为一定的请求次数,用户应尽量避免频繁查询。实现异步调用或数据缓存机制可以有效降低调用频率,提高API请求的效率。

3. 火币API的文档获取和使用方法有哪些?
火币官网提供了详尽的API文档,其中包括API的各类请求示例、参数说明、返回结果分析等。用户可以通过如下方式获取API文档:
ul
   li登录火币账号,进入API管理界面,查看链接。/li
   li访问火币官网,在底部的链接中找到“API文档”,并进行查阅。/li
/ul
使用文档时,建议全面了解各个API功能,以便合理组织代码和请求结构,减少不必要的错误调用。

4. 如何进行API调试?
进行API调试有利于快速发现和解决问题。常用的调试工具有Postman、cURL等。开发者可以使用这些工具发送HTTP请求,测试你的API调用是否有效。在调试时,注意以下几点:
ul
   li使用API密钥和签名进行身份验证,以避免因认证失败导致的问题。/li
   li关注接口返回的状态码和信息,结合API文档的错误码说明,逐步定位问题。/li
   li实现日志记录,帮助追踪请求的信息和时间,便于后续的审核和问题解决。/li
/ul

5. 使用火币API需要哪些基本知识?
为了有效使用火币API,开发者需要具备以下基本知识:
ul
   listrong网络编程:/strong掌握HTTP协议和RESTful API的基本知识,可以理解数据的请求和响应过程。/li
   listrong编程语言:/strong至少熟悉一种编程语言如Python、Java或JavaScript,因为开发者需要用这些语言编写代码请求API。/li
   listrong数据处理:/strong懂得处理JSON格式的请求和响应数据,以便能有效提取和使用API返回的数据。/li
/ul

6. 如何API调用的性能?
API调用的性能可以显著提高应用的响应速度和用户体验。如下是性能的一些方法:
ul
   listrong批量处理:/strong对于多次获取数据的场景,尽量使用批量请求而非单次请求,以减少请求次数。/li
   listrong数据缓存:/strong将频繁访问的数据缓存起来,降低每次请求的消耗,避免重复查询。/li
   listrong延迟加载:/strong可以应用懒加载策略,在用户真正需要时再发起API请求,进一步提升速度。/li
/ul

通过以上的介绍,希望能够帮助开发者更好地理解和使用火币区块链API,从而推动他们在加密货币领域的项目开发和应用落地。

【翻译:以上为火币区块链API的全面解析以及相关问题的详细解答,便于用户更好地理解和使用火币的技术工具。】  全面解析火币区块链API:构建你的加密货币应用之路 / 
 guanjianci 火币API, 区块链技术, 加密货币交易, 开发者工具 /guanjianci 

什么是火币区块链API?
火币区块链API是火币交易所提供的一组程序接口,允许开发者与火币平台进行直接的交互。这些API可以用来执行多种操作,包括获取市场数据、进行交易、管理账户等功能。这些接口使用REST架构,能够支持RESTful API调用,对于开发者来说具有较高的易用性。

火币作为全球领先的数字资产交易平台,其API被广泛应用于多种加密货币应用的开发。不论是个人开发者还是大型企业,都可以通过火币API接口实现快速的功能集成和系统搭建。由于其开放性和灵活性,火币API在区块链开发者圈中占有重要地位。

火币API提供哪些功能?
火币区块链API提供了一系列功能,包括但不限于:
ul
   listrong市场数据查询:/strong可以获取实时的市场行情,包括价格、交易量、买卖深度等信息。/li
   listrong用户账户管理:/strong用户可以通过API进行账户信息的查询、修改及管理,包括资产查询、交易历史等。/li
   listrong交易功能:/strong用户可以使用API发起新订单、撤单、查询订单状态等操作。/li
   listrong安全性措施:/strong支持多种身份验证方式,保障用户数据和资金的安全。/li
/ul

如何使用火币区块链API进行交易?
使用火币API进行交易主要包括几个步骤。首先,你需要创建一个火币账户并完成身份验证。之后,访问火币API的开发者中心,申请API密钥,并配置相关权限。接下来,你可以使用编程语言(如Python、Java等)调用API进行交易操作。以下是使用火币API进行交易的一般步骤:


1. strong获取API密钥:/strong在火币官网上登录账户,访问API管理页面,获取你的API钥匙和密钥。一定要妥善保管这些信息,以防被恶意使用。



2. strong选择合适的编程语言:/strong火币API支持多种编程语言,你可以根据自己的开发环境选择如Python或JavaScript等流行语言。



3. strong进行Api调用:/strong使用HTTP请求方法(如GET、POST)进行API调用。你可以查看火币API文档,了解各种请求的具体参数和返回值结构。



4. strong处理返回结果:/strong成功发起交易后,你将收到交易状态的返回信息。你需要根据这些返回结果进行相应的处理。


火币API的安全性策略有哪些?
安全性是火币API设计中的重中之重。火币交易所采取了多种安全机制,确保用户的交易和数据不受侵犯。主要的安全措施包括:
ul
   listrongAPI密钥管理:/strong用户在创建API密钥时,可以自行设定相应的权限,包括仅允许查询、仅允许交易等,这样在一定程度上降低了风险。/li
   listrongIP白名单:/strong用户可以设置允许访问API的IP地址,这样即便API密钥被盗用,也无法从非白名单的IP地址进行操作。/li
   listrong请求签名:/strong所有通过API进行的请求,都需要进行签名处理,确保请求的完整性和合法性。/li
/ul

常见问题及解答

1. 如何解决API调用失败的问题?
当调用火币API遇到失败时,首先需要查看返回的错误码和错误信息。火币API文档中对各种错误进行了详细解释。常见的错误包括401(未授权)、429(请求频率过高)、500(服务器错误)等。对于401错误,通常是因为API密钥无效或未授权,需检查密钥的设置与权限;对于429错误,要减少请求频率,避免频繁调用;而500错误需要等待火币服务器恢复正常,或是联系火币客服解决。
建议在开发时实现错误处理机制,定期重试失败的请求,并合理安排API的调用频率,遵循火币API的速率限制说明。

2. 火币API的调用频率限制是怎样的?
火币对API调用频率设有严格限制,不同的API权限设置有不同的限制标准。具体的频率限制可以在火币API文档中查找。一般情况下,用户将不能在短时间内持续发送请求,而应在发送API请求后,遵循一定的休眠时间。
例如,对于市场查询类API的调用,可能在一分钟内限制为一定的请求次数,用户应尽量避免频繁查询。实现异步调用或数据缓存机制可以有效降低调用频率,提高API请求的效率。

3. 火币API的文档获取和使用方法有哪些?
火币官网提供了详尽的API文档,其中包括API的各类请求示例、参数说明、返回结果分析等。用户可以通过如下方式获取API文档:
ul
   li登录火币账号,进入API管理界面,查看链接。/li
   li访问火币官网,在底部的链接中找到“API文档”,并进行查阅。/li
/ul
使用文档时,建议全面了解各个API功能,以便合理组织代码和请求结构,减少不必要的错误调用。

4. 如何进行API调试?
进行API调试有利于快速发现和解决问题。常用的调试工具有Postman、cURL等。开发者可以使用这些工具发送HTTP请求,测试你的API调用是否有效。在调试时,注意以下几点:
ul
   li使用API密钥和签名进行身份验证,以避免因认证失败导致的问题。/li
   li关注接口返回的状态码和信息,结合API文档的错误码说明,逐步定位问题。/li
   li实现日志记录,帮助追踪请求的信息和时间,便于后续的审核和问题解决。/li
/ul

5. 使用火币API需要哪些基本知识?
为了有效使用火币API,开发者需要具备以下基本知识:
ul
   listrong网络编程:/strong掌握HTTP协议和RESTful API的基本知识,可以理解数据的请求和响应过程。/li
   listrong编程语言:/strong至少熟悉一种编程语言如Python、Java或JavaScript,因为开发者需要用这些语言编写代码请求API。/li
   listrong数据处理:/strong懂得处理JSON格式的请求和响应数据,以便能有效提取和使用API返回的数据。/li
/ul

6. 如何API调用的性能?
API调用的性能可以显著提高应用的响应速度和用户体验。如下是性能的一些方法:
ul
   listrong批量处理:/strong对于多次获取数据的场景,尽量使用批量请求而非单次请求,以减少请求次数。/li
   listrong数据缓存:/strong将频繁访问的数据缓存起来,降低每次请求的消耗,避免重复查询。/li
   listrong延迟加载:/strong可以应用懒加载策略,在用户真正需要时再发起API请求,进一步提升速度。/li
/ul

通过以上的介绍,希望能够帮助开发者更好地理解和使用火币区块链API,从而推动他们在加密货币领域的项目开发和应用落地。

【翻译:以上为火币区块链API的全面解析以及相关问题的详细解答,便于用户更好地理解和使用火币的技术工具。】
                  分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                      相关新闻

                                                      抱歉,我无法生成超过2
                                                      2024-08-27
                                                      抱歉,我无法生成超过2

                                                      ### 区块链项目私募币的定义 私募币(Private Placement Token)是指在区块链项目中,通过私募方式发行的数字资产或加密...

                                                      2023年区块链技术最新样板
                                                      2025-01-26
                                                      2023年区块链技术最新样板

                                                      随着科技的迅猛发展,区块链技术已从最初的比特币基础设施演变为多种应用的核心支柱。2023年,随着应用场景的不...

                                                      2023年欧洲区块链发展最新
                                                      2025-04-06
                                                      2023年欧洲区块链发展最新

                                                      近年来,区块链技术的迅猛发展对于各个行业都产生了深远的影响,尤其是在经济、金融和科技领域。作为全球区块...

                                                      陕西区块链最新发展:探
                                                      2024-08-30
                                                      陕西区块链最新发展:探

                                                      随着区块链技术的逐步成熟和应用范围的不断拓展,陕西省在这一领域同样取得了显著的进展。在数字经济的浪潮中...

                                                      <font dropzone="bv5hl6"></font><noscript date-time="ma8yl5"></noscript><area draggable="ks1bv2"></area><map dir="wq_3cm"></map><acronym draggable="7zdjo6"></acronym><font draggable="gpcw2r"></font><dfn lang="9cwwbn"></dfn><pre id="4f1w3f"></pre><dfn lang="lsx7e1"></dfn><small dropzone="ph7msi"></small><small id="hm4y5y"></small><kbd dropzone="1zrsek"></kbd><var lang="0jup7_"></var><code lang="m5bm1j"></code><address lang="0_44ja"></address><pre dir="hlb_x3"></pre><center id="x_dngt"></center><area date-time="1k5nnm"></area><area dir="8yuef1"></area><var dir="5_5whb"></var><map lang="hu7o95"></map><address id="w2241u"></address><legend dir="z07w_p"></legend><b date-time="6hw13a"></b><acronym draggable="qefrjf"></acronym><ol dropzone="_ycjn6"></ol><em lang="5e6hgm"></em><u dir="vd8gdp"></u><kbd draggable="iapgxv"></kbd><ol date-time="gqhvcy"></ol><acronym id="i4h1j4"></acronym><var dir="py0rs5"></var><ins draggable="_bfujv"></ins><legend id="izor4a"></legend><map date-time="bxqkp8"></map><time id="eu5yu6"></time><em dropzone="_zherf"></em><time dropzone="k1h734"></time><bdo dir="pcuzne"></bdo><noframes date-time="b2a801">